首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用JavaScript在引导程序<li class=" list -group-item">中添加列表

要在HTML中的<li class="list-group-item">元素内添加列表项,可以使用JavaScript来动态创建和插入这些元素。以下是一个简单的示例,展示了如何使用JavaScript来实现这一点:

HTML结构

首先,确保你的HTML结构中有一个<ul>元素,它将包含所有的列表项:

代码语言:txt
复制
<ul id="myList" class="list-group">
  <!-- 列表项将在这里动态添加 -->
</ul>

JavaScript代码

然后,使用JavaScript来创建新的<li>元素,并将它们添加到<ul>中:

代码语言:txt
复制
// 获取ul元素
var ul = document.getElementById('myList');

// 创建一个新的li元素
var li = document.createElement('li');
li.className = 'list-group-item'; // 设置类名
li.textContent = '新的列表项'; // 设置文本内容

// 将新的li元素添加到ul中
ul.appendChild(li);

解释

  1. 获取<ul>元素:使用document.getElementById方法获取页面上的<ul>元素。
  2. 创建新的<li>元素:使用document.createElement方法创建一个新的<li>元素。
  3. 设置类名和文本内容:通过.className属性设置<li>元素的类名为list-group-item,并通过.textContent属性设置其显示的文本。
  4. 添加到<ul>:使用.appendChild方法将新的<li>元素添加到<ul>元素的子节点列表的末尾。

扩展功能

如果你想添加多个列表项,可以将上述代码放入一个循环中,或者创建一个函数来处理添加多个列表项的逻辑:

代码语言:txt
复制
function addListItem(text) {
  var ul = document.getElementById('myList');
  var li = document.createElement('li');
  li.className = 'list-group-item';
  li.textContent = text;
  ul.appendChild(li);
}

// 添加多个列表项
addListItem('列表项1');
addListItem('列表项2');
addListItem('列表项3');

这样,你可以轻松地通过调用addListItem函数并传入不同的文本参数来添加任意数量的列表项。

应用场景

这种方法在需要动态更新页面内容的场合非常有用,例如:

  • 用户交互后更新列表(如添加待办事项)。
  • 从服务器获取数据并显示在页面上。
  • 实现动态表单或配置界面。

通过这种方式,你可以灵活地控制页面内容的生成和更新,提高用户体验和应用的功能性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的文章

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券